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den by train

Planning a train journey from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den? The trip usually takes about 3hrs 14 mins, covering approximately 87 miles (141 kilometres). With roughly 42 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£11.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

What are my cheap ticket options for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den start from as little as £11.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den start from £49.90 one way, or £50.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Isleworth to Hampton-in-Arden are available for £90.50 one way, or £145.50 return

With our FairSplit technology, you can save up to 90% on the cost of train travel.

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Isleworth Train Station

Isleworth Station may be petite, but it ensures smooth rail travel for all passengers. While there is no traditional ticket office, ticket machines are present for the collection of online purchases. These machines are equipped to provide the best service to customers with disabilities, offering t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

While the station lacks some conveniences such as wa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shment facilities, it compensates with step-free access, making it partially accessible for individuals with mobility concerns. Commuters can feel reassured with the presence of CCTV and customer help points, enhancing safety at the station.

Facilities and Amenities

The station provides a range of essential facilities design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Ticket purchasing options are readily available with a ticket office open on weekdays and Saturdays and ticket machines that facilitate the collection of online purchases. However, it's worth noting the absence of accessible ticket machines, which could pose a challenge for some travelers. For real-time updates, passengers can rely on departure screens and announcements throughout the station.

Those seeking assistance can find it at the help point or the ticket office from Monday to Saturday. There's also the comfort of a Secure Station Scheme accreditation, offering peace of mind in terms of safety, although unfortunately, there's no luggage storage or waiting room available.

Accessibility Features

Hampton-in-Arden station has made strides in becoming more accessible, providing some step-free access though it’s crucial to check specific travel requirements in advance as access may be limited to one direction solely. Furthermore, facilities such as ramps for train access and an induction loop system are in place to support those with mobility or hearing impairments. However, there are no accessible toilets or wheelchairs available on-site.
